About the role

LOCATION: Rota, Spain.

We are currently looking for a Nurse (known internally as a Near Patient Nurse) to deliver our

Near Patient Program in Spain, supporting our TRICARE contract. This role is to be based in and

covers Rota, but there might be requirements to travel to other locations within Spain.

Our Nurses provide medical case management and communication when a patient is requiring

care from a local public/private healthcare provider. The Nurse will work collaboratively with the

provider to manage the care of the patient keeping them at the center of all considerations.

Escalations to senior Near Patient Team members including the Near Patient Nurse Team Lead

and the Near Patient Physician Lead will be required based on the clinical findings.

Key responsibilities

  • Provide comprehensive In-patient clinical case management for a patient where they will be completing status reports upon admission and whilst the patient remains admitted to the provider.
  • In the pursuit of medical updates, the Nurse may visit the provider, or assist with calling providers or treating doctors for medical information for geographically remote cases as required. 
  • In person support to beneficiaries admitted on purchased care sector, with the goal to assist in navigating cultural and possible language barriers, helping in understanding differences in local health care settings and obtaining possible feedbacks on care received.
  • Be prepared to liaise with providers and patients, to obtain detailed clinical information including past medical history to allow for accurate on-going case management.
  • Where the Nurse feels care is suboptimal, not necessary, or potentially harmful to the patient the Nurse must escalate such matters to the Near Patient Physician Lead or Near Patient Regional Medical Director for discussion.
  • Upon discharge, support when required with the Near Patient Medical Collection Team to obtain the discharge summary and hospital records from the provider, ensuring that the medical information correlates with the information obtained during admission and update the medical records accordingly.
  • Provide, when feasible, on-site patient.
  • Establish and maintain the relationships with providers; leveraging these relationships for clinical quality assurance and oversight
  • Provide extensive medical case management, receiving calls from patients and performing telephonic triage/holistic medical assessment, providing risk-assessed evidence-based medical advice and medical direction to patients and directing them to the best medical facilities in a specific location 
  • Liaising with medical professionals to obtain medical information about patients, coordinate medical treatment and making recommendations on change/upgrade in care; 
  • Arranging medical evacuations and repatriations, either via commercial carrier (with medical escorts) or air ambulance 
  • Being involved in internal quality-improvement projects
